ATTACHMENT T0 AEP:NRC:0400 1
The responses are provided to the corresponding items as cited in the bulletin.
Item 1:
Units 1 and 2 of the Donald C.
Cook Nuclear Plant contain flued head design for containment penetration connections as illustrated in figure NE-1120-1, Minter 1975 Addenda of the ASME 8 8 P.V.
Code.
Item 2:
2a)
The containment penetrations at Donald C.
Cook Nuclear Plant were designed as per ANSI 831.1, 1967 code and fabricated/in-stalled as per ASME Section III B 5 P.V. code, 1958 Edition.
2b)
All butt welds, described in IE Bulletin 80-08 were inspected during construction using radiographic examinations.
2c)
Single vee-butt welds were used to attach the flued head to the outer sleeve of the containment penetrations.
These welds were made in the fabricators'hop and the penetrations were shipped to the plant site as an assembly.
No backing bars were used in the sield fabrication.
2d)
Radiographic testing of the welds was done as per the acceptance standards of the ASME code,Section III.
Any repairs which had to be performed on the shop welds identified in the bulletin, were made in accordance with ASME Section III, 1968 Edition.
Iteii> 3:
Since all the examinations conducted on the subject weld were by radiographic examination, this. item is not applicable to Donald C.
Cook Nuclear Plant.
